MySQL中AI是什么意思(mysql中ai表示)
2023-06-13 09:19:42 时间
MySQL中是什么意思?
在MySQL中,是指“自动递增”。自动递增是一种数据类型属性,用于指定将在向表中插入新记录时自动分配的唯一标识符。当此属性设置为某一表的主键时,该表中的每个记录都将具有唯一的键值。
是MySQL数据库中非常常见的数据类型属性。如果您打算使用MySQL中的属性,下面是一些有关如何使用该属性的实例代码:
创建一个名为“customers”的表并将其设置为自动递增
CREATE TABLE customers (
id INT NOT NULL AUTO_INCREMENT, name VARCHAR(255) NOT NULL,
address VARCHAR(255) NOT NULL, PRIMARY KEY (id)
);
在上面的代码中,我们创建了一个名为“customers”的表,并将其设置为自动递增。我们使用“id”列作为主键,每次插入新记录时都会自动递增。
在向具有属性的表中插入新纪录时,不需要指定列的值。MySQL会自动将唯一值分配给每个新记录。以下是一个基本的示例:
向表中插入新纪录
INSERT INTO customers (name, address)
VALUES ("John Smith", "123 Mn St");
在上面的代码中,我们没有指定“id”列的值,但MySQL会自动将唯一的“id”值分配给新纪录。
可以使用以下代码来查看自增长的值:
SELECT LAST_INSERT_ID();
在上面的代码中,我们使用LAST_INSERT_ID()函数来获取最后插入的记录的主键值。请注意,LAST_INSERT_ID()对于每个MySQL连接都是唯一的,这意味着您不必担心同时插入了多个记录时可能出现的冲突。
总结
在MySQL中使用属性可以轻松地分配唯一的主键值,并使数据尽可能准确和规范化。当设置属性时,请考虑所需的数据类型和最大值,以确保它们与您的数据类型和需求匹配。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 MySQL中AI是什么意思(mysql中ai表示)
相关文章
- PHP操作MySQL数据库:实现快速连接(php连接数据库mysql)
- MySQL文件:知识必备(什么是mysql文件)
- MySQL读写分离:提升性能的利器(什么是mysql读写分离)
- MySQL连接已失效:怎么办?(mysql连接失效)
- MySQL中搜索有助于提高效率(mysql搜索数据库)
- 什么MySQL:添加索引命令指南(mysql添加索引命令是)
- MySQL如何创建表:一步一步指南(mysql如何创建表)
- MySQL数据库中的事件的用途与实现方法(mysql数据库事件)
- MySQL:了解不同类型的索引(mysql什么索引)
- MySQL如何修改外键约束(mysql 修改外键约束)
- MySQL数据库知识大全,详解MySQL的各种用法,包括基础语法、高级应用等。涵盖广泛,适合初学者及进阶者。(mysql大全)
- 探秘MySQL以什么开头的索引最优(mysql中以什么开头的)
- MySQL中的临时表是什么(mysql中什么是临时表)
- MySQL 中的符号具体是什么含义(mysql中 =什么意思)
- MySQL中事务一种保证数据完整性的机制(mysql中事务是什么)
- MySQL中使用AND条件的方法(mysql中且用什么)
- MySQL中的TBD指的是什么(mysql中tbd是啥)
- MySQL中的MUL是什么 了解MySQL中的MUL关键字(mysql中mul是什么)
- 深入了解MySQL解析ID字段含义与作用(mysql中id是什么)
- 在CMD中快速使用MySQL(cmd中mysql操作)
- MySQL判断数据非数字的方法详解(mysql中判断为非数字)
- Mysql与Zookeeper集成如何提高数据系统的可靠性(mysql zk)
- 突破局限MySQL不再被限于特定领域(mysql不在什么范围类)
- 如何选择适合的MySQL版本下载(mysql下载什么版本号)
- MySQL 数据库去年发生了什么(mysql 上年)
- 一举两得MySQL上传同时查询,速度更快(mysql上传同时查询)